Skip to content

Commit 8d024ec

Browse files
authored
Remove useless nacos and sentinel and add envs for adservice values (#33)
* Remove useless nacos and sentinel and add envs for adservice values * Update chart version * Update values default
1 parent 42a37f5 commit 8d024ec

File tree

2 files changed

+22
-52
lines changed

2 files changed

+22
-52
lines changed

charts/opentelemetry-demo/Chart.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
apiVersion: v2
22
name: opentelemetry-demo
33
type: application
4-
version: 0.1.7
4+
version: 0.2.0
55
description: A helm chart for openTelemetry community demo application integration with other component.
66
sources:
77
- https://github.com/openinsight-proj/opentelemetry-demo-helm-chart

charts/opentelemetry-demo/values.yaml

Lines changed: 21 additions & 51 deletions
Original file line numberDiff line numberDiff line change
@@ -55,13 +55,33 @@ opentelemetry-demo:
5555

5656
adService:
5757
enabled: true
58-
image: ghcr.m.daocloud.io/openinsight-proj/opentelemetry-demo-helm-chart/adservice:v0.1.7
58+
image: ghcr.m.daocloud.io/openinsight-proj/opentelemetry-demo-helm-chart/adservice:v0.2.0
5959
servicePort: 9555
6060
ports:
6161
- name: http
6262
value: 8081
6363
- name: health-http
6464
value: 8999
65+
env:
66+
- name: AD_SERVICE_PORT
67+
value: '9555'
68+
- name: NACSO_NAMESPACE_ID
69+
value: ''
70+
- name: NACSO_GROUP_NAME
71+
value: DEFAULT_GROUP
72+
- name: SKOALA_REGISTRY
73+
value: nacos-test
74+
- name: K8S_NAMESPACE
75+
valueFrom:
76+
fieldRef:
77+
apiVersion: v1
78+
fieldPath: metadata.namespace
79+
- name: OTEL_RESOURCE_ATTRIBUTES
80+
value: >-
81+
k8s.namespace.name=$(K8S_NAMESPACE),k8s.node.name=$(OTEL_RESOURCE_ATTRIBUTES_NODE_NAME),k8s.pod.name=$(OTEL_RESOURCE_ATTRIBUTES_POD_NAME),k8s.pod.uid=$(OTEL_RESOURCE_ATTRIBUTES_POD_UID),skoala.registry=$(SKOALA_REGISTRY),nacos.namespaceid=$(NACSO_NAMESPACE_ID),nacos.groupname=$(NACSO_GROUP_NAME)
82+
- name: JAVA_OPTS
83+
value: -Dspring.cloud.nacos.config.server-addr=nacos-test.skoala-jia:8848 -Dspring.application.name=adservice-springcloud -Dspring.cloud.nacos.discovery.enabled=true -Dspring.cloud.nacos.discovery.server-addr=nacos-test.skoala-jia:8848 -Dspring.cloud.nacos.config.discovery.metadata.k8s_cluster_id=xxx -Dspring.cloud.nacos.config.discovery.metadata.k8s_cluster_name=skoala-dev -Dspring.cloud.nacos.config.discovery.metadata.k8s_namespace_name=skoala-jia -Dspring.cloud.nacos.config.discovery.metadata.k8s_workload_type=deployment -Dspring.cloud.nacos.config.discovery.metadata.k8s_workload_name=adservice-springcloud -Dspring.cloud.nacos.config.discovery.metadata.k8s_service_name=adservice-springcloud -Dspring.cloud.nacos.config.discovery.metadata.k8s_pod_name=$(HOSTNAME) -Dspring.cloud.sentinel.enabled=true -Dspring.cloud.sentinel.transport.dashboard=nacos-test-sentinel:8080
84+
6585
podAnnotations:
6686
instrumentation.opentelemetry.io/inject-sdk: 'true'
6787
sidecar.opentelemetry.io/inject: 'false'
@@ -129,58 +149,8 @@ opentelemetry-demo:
129149
instrumentation.opentelemetry.io/inject-sdk: 'true'
130150
sidecar.opentelemetry.io/inject: 'false'
131151

132-
133152
shippingService:
134153
enabled: true
135154
podAnnotations:
136155
instrumentation.opentelemetry.io/inject-sdk: 'true'
137156
sidecar.opentelemetry.io/inject: 'false'
138-
139-
nacos:
140-
enabled: false
141-
version: 2.1.0
142-
replicaCount: 1
143-
image:
144-
repository: docker.m.daocloud.io/nacos/nacos-server
145-
tag: "v2.1.0-slim"
146-
nameOverride: "nacos-server"
147-
fullnameOverride: "nacos-server"
148-
service:
149-
type: NodePort
150-
port: 8848
151-
grpcPort1: 9848
152-
grpcPort2: 9849
153-
env:
154-
mode: standalone
155-
jvmXms: 1g
156-
jvmXmx: 1g
157-
jvmXmn: 512m
158-
resources:
159-
limits:
160-
cpu: 1024m
161-
memory: 1024Mi
162-
requests:
163-
cpu: 1024m
164-
memory: 1024Mi
165-
166-
sentinel:
167-
enabled: false
168-
version: 1.8.4
169-
replicaCount:
170-
image:
171-
repository: ghcr.m.daocloud.io/openinsight-proj/opentelemetry-demo-helm-chart/sentinel
172-
tag: "1.8.4"
173-
nameOverride: "sentinel-server"
174-
fullnameOverride: "sentinel-server"
175-
service:
176-
type: NodePort
177-
port: 34001
178-
env:
179-
javaopts: "-Dserver.port=34001 -Dcsp.sentinel.dashboard.server=0.0.0.0:34001 -Dproject.name=sentinel-dashboard"
180-
resources:
181-
limits:
182-
cpu: 400m
183-
memory: 512Mi
184-
requests:
185-
cpu: 100m
186-
memory: 200Mi

0 commit comments

Comments
 (0)